L.K. Bennett market overview
L.K. Bennett sits in the upper tier of the UK accessible-luxury womenswear segment - above Phase Eight and Hobbs in price perception, roughly level with Reiss, and a clear distance below true luxury players. The UK mid-market womenswear category is competitive and moderately consolidated, with a handful of brands - Reiss, Ted Baker, Hobbs, Karen Millen - occupying overlapping positions and competing heavily on promotional activity and digital reach. Average order values in this segment typically sit in the £150-£300 range for clothing, with footwear orders pulling slightly higher.
Promotional cadence in this category is intense. End-of-season sales, Black Friday events, and flash discount codes are now structural rather than exceptional, which creates an interesting dynamic: full-price buying in this segment is increasingly a minority behaviour. Shoppers familiar with the brand's promotional rhythm tend to wait. That pattern is reflected in the current code distribution - 30 deals and 3 active voucher codes live simultaneously, with discounts spanning 10% to 80%, suggests an active clearance posture rather than selective promotion.
Customer acquisition leans heavily on organic search, editorial coverage, and royal or celebrity association - L.K. Bennett has long benefited from high-profile wearers without running overt endorsement campaigns. Repeat purchase rates in occasionwear tend to be lower than everyday fashion, but customers who find a reliable fit and aesthetic in this category show strong loyalty. The brand's online channel now carries most of the commercial weight, with a smaller but visible physical store estate in premium UK locations supplementing digital sales.
About L.K. Bennett
L.K. Bennett occupies a specific and somewhat rarefied corner of British fashion: polished occasionwear, heels that look grown-up, and dresses that could go to a wedding, a board meeting, or both. The range is built around a fairly consistent aesthetic - structured silhouettes, quality fabrics, restrained colour palettes - and it hasn't deviated much from that formula in decades. That consistency is either a strength or a limitation, depending on whether you need what it does.
The website stocks clothing, shoes, bags, and accessories, with dresses and footwear as the clear headline acts. Navigation is clean enough. Product pages give good detail on fabric composition and fit, which matters when you're spending this kind of money on something you can't try on from your sofa. Sizes tend to run fairly standard UK, though reviews across the web suggest fit can vary by category - shoes are generally reliable, while structured dresses occasionally run narrow across the shoulders.
What's genuinely good: the quality at full price is defensible. You're not paying Chanel money, but the garments are a clear step above high street. What's less good: full-price L.K. Bennett is expensive for what it is. Competitors like Reiss and Hobbs offer comparable quality and styling at broadly similar price points, and both have stronger physical retail presences. Ted Baker and Phase Eight are also in the conversation. Against Reiss in particular, L.K. Bennett sometimes feels slightly more conservative - which will suit some buyers perfectly and put others off entirely.
Delivery: standard UK delivery is charged unless you hit a qualifying spend threshold, and next-day options are available at a premium. Returns are accepted within a set window, though you'll want to check the current policy on the site before assuming free returns - this is an area where mid-market fashion brands quietly change the terms. International delivery is available, but costs and timescales vary significantly by destination.

Honest verdict: L.K. Bennett is for someone who has a specific need - a smart occasion, a recurring requirement for professional dressing - and wants something that won't embarrass them in five years. If you're shopping purely for trend or everyday casual wear, this isn't your brand. But if the archive sale is running at 80% off and you wear this kind of thing, it becomes very hard to ignore.
How to use a L.K. Bennett discount code
- Find a code on this page that matches your purchase - check any conditions, such as minimum spend or whether it applies to sale items, before you copy it.
- Head to lkbennett.com, browse, and add whatever you want to your basket. Don't assume codes work on already-discounted lines - many don't.
- Go to your basket and proceed towards checkout. You'll be asked to sign in or continue as a guest.
- On the order summary page, look for a field labelled something like "Promo Code" or "Discount Code" - it's typically visible in the right-hand panel alongside your order total. It does not auto-apply; you need to type or paste the code manually.
- Hit "Apply" and confirm the discount has been deducted before entering your payment details. If it hasn't updated, the code may have expired, may not apply to your specific items, or the minimum spend threshold may not have been met.
- Complete checkout as normal. Keep your confirmation email - it's your proof of purchase if anything goes wrong with the order or a return.
